The electron, neutron, and proton, listed in descending order of mass are

A

Electron, neutron, proton

B

Electron, proton, neutron

C

Proton, neutron, electron

D

Neutron, proton, electron

Text Solution

AI Generated Solution

The correct Answer is:
To list the electron, neutron, and proton in descending order of mass, we can follow these steps: ### Step 1: Identify the Mass of Each Particle - **Electron (e)**: The mass of an electron is approximately \(9.11 \times 10^{-31}\) kg or about \(0.00054858\) atomic mass units (u). - **Proton (p)**: The mass of a proton is approximately \(1.67 \times 10^{-27}\) kg or about \(1.007276\) u. - **Neutron (n)**: The mass of a neutron is approximately \(1.68 \times 10^{-27}\) kg or about \(1.008665\) u. ### Step 2: Compare the Masses - From the values identified, we can see that: - Neutron: \(1.008665\) u - Proton: \(1.007276\) u - Electron: \(0.00054858\) u ### Step 3: Arrange in Descending Order - Since we are arranging in descending order of mass, we start with the heaviest: 1. Neutron (n) 2. Proton (p) 3. Electron (e) ### Final Answer The order of the particles in descending order of mass is: **Neutron > Proton > Electron**
